About Castro Valley, CA
As a Travel Occupational Therapist in Castro Valley, CA here's what you should know:- The cost of living in Castro Valley is higher than the national average, particularly in terms of housing costs.
- Wages may be higher to match the increased cost of living.
- In summer, average highs are around 80°F, and average lows are around 55°F.
- In winter, average highs are around 60°F, and average lows are around 40°F.
- Short term rentals and furnished housing options are available in Castro Valley, and they can be found with some research and advance planning.
- Castro Valley is car-friendly, and public transportation options are available, including buses and BART (Bay Area Rapid Transit) for easy access to nearby cities.
- Castro Valley has a diverse population with a wide age range.
- Common health issues may include allergies and respiratory conditions due to the pollen and air quality.
- There is a sizable population of travel nurses in the area.
- There are plenty of restaurants offering diverse cuisines, and the nearby Bay Area provides access to a vibrant art and music scene.
- Sports enthusiasts can enjoy outdoor activities such as hiking in the surrounding hills and exploring nearby parks.
